Qinzhou (Chinese: 秦州; pinyin: Qínzhōu), formerly romanized as Tsinchow, is a district and the seat of the city of Tianshui, Gansu province, China.
It is named for its former position as the seat of the medieval Chinese province of Qinzhou.
[2] It is the political, economic and cultural center of Tianshui.
[3] Qinzhou has an area of 2,442 km2 (943 sq mi) and a population of 656,689 as of 2021.
[4][5] Qinzhou District is divided to 7 subdistricts and 16 towns.
